The Rise of Single Page Applications in Modern Web Development

Web development has evolved rapidly, with single-page applications (SPAs) leading the way. These modern applications eliminate page reloads, creating fluid, app-like experiences. React, Vue, and Angular power most SPAs, each offering distinct benefits. Meanwhile, WebAssembly (WASM) pushes web performance closer to native speeds, unlocking new possibilities for browser-based applications. Additionally, API-first development is reshaping how web services interact, ensuring seamless integration across platforms. Companies looking to stay ahead must embrace these technologies.
Single Page Applications and Modern Frontend Frameworks
Single Page Applications (SPAs) have changed the way users interact with websites. They create experiences that feel more like desktop applications than traditional web pages. These applications load once and update content dynamically as users move around, which eliminates those annoying page refreshes we saw on older websites.
React, Vue, and Angular: Comparing Approaches
Three major frontend frameworks dominate the SPA landscape today. Each framework has its philosophy and strengths that make it suitable for different projects.
React, 74.2% of front-end developers use this Facebook-developed framework as of 2020. Its component-based architecture and virtual DOM implementation make it perfect for rendering complex, data-heavy interfaces. React’s rich ecosystem of libraries gives developers tremendous flexibility, making it perfect for projects that need custom approaches. Many top web development companies choose React for enterprise-level applications because of these advantages.
Vue.js, created by Evan You, takes the best parts of React and Angular to create a framework that developers can adopt step by step. Vue works great for rapid prototyping and smaller to medium-sized applications thanks to its easy learning curve and minimalistic core. Developers love Vue for its clean syntax, excellent documentation, and fast rendering capabilities.
Google’s Angular comes packed with built-in tools for routing, form validation, and state management. The framework uses TypeScript for strong typing, which helps create robust code. This makes Angular valuable for big enterprise applications where code maintenance is vital. Many custom web development companies pick Angular for complex, long-term projects with large teams.
Development teams should think about these points when picking a framework:
- React and Vue load faster than Angular at first
- Angular gives you everything but takes longer to learn
- Vue.js is the easiest to start with and works great for new developers
- React’s flexibility and huge ecosystem let you build exactly what you want
Benefits for User Navigation and Experience
SPAs make the user experience better by providing smooth, app-like interactions. Users don’t wait for entire pages to reload. Instead, SPAs update just the parts that need to change, which creates a quick and fluid experience.
This approach brings clear benefits:
- Dramatically faster interactions – SPAs respond almost instantly after they first load because they only fetch the data they need
- Reduced bounce rates – Quick-loading, interactive pages keep users around longer
- Seamless navigation – Users get an uninterrupted experience as they move between sections
- Mobile-friendly performance – SPAs work great on mobile devices because they transfer less data
- App-like experience – Users get a continuous experience that feels like using a desktop or mobile app
These benefits lead to real business results. Users are 32% more likely to leave a page when load times jump from one to three seconds. The speed of SPAs helps improve conversion rates and keeps customers happy.
Web development companies often use caching in SPAs to make them even faster. They store resources like HTML, CSS, and JavaScript after the first load, which makes moving around the site quick. Client-side routing also helps create smooth transitions between content areas by cutting out server requests.
SPAs can turn simple website visits into engaging digital experiences when skilled developers build them right. They keep users connected to content in ways traditional websites can’t match.
API-First Development by Web Development Services Companies
API-first development has become a key strategy for leading web development services companies. These companies put APIs at the heart of software development instead of adding them later. The process starts by designing clear interfaces before writing any application code. This approach leads to better teamwork, code reuse, and adaptability throughout development.
Microservices Architecture Benefits
Modern API-first development goes hand in hand with microservices architecture. This setup improves upon monolithic systems by breaking applications into separate services that talk through APIs.
Custom web development services companies like Appello find these benefits in microservices:
Development moves faster – Small teams can work on individual services without coordinating changes across the entire application. Teams can release components faster because they don’t affect other system parts.
Better scaling – Each microservice scales on its own based on what it needs. This targeted approach saves resources and cuts maintenance costs.
Faults stay contained – Services run on their own, so failures don’t spread through the system. Circuit breakers protect server resources when services stop responding.
Technology choices expand – Teams can pick the best programming language for each service. Businesses can use specialized tools for specific tasks.
How APIs Enable Omnichannel Experiences
Omnichannel strategies have become vital in today’s customer-focused world. API-first development forms the foundation of successful omnichannel systems.
“By leveraging an API-led approach, organizations can develop more meaningful relationships with their customers and improve customer engagement—moving beyond transactions through multi-channel engagement”. This approach keeps experiences consistent no matter how customers interact with a brand.
Top web development services companies follow these best practices for omnichannel API development:
- Standardization – APIs keep data formats and communication protocols consistent across channels. Customers get the same experience at every touchpoint.
- Quick updates – Well-designed APIs update data instantly across all channels. Customers see current information whether they use websites, or mobile apps, or visit physical locations.
- Complete customer profiles – APIs combine customer data from many sources. This creates detailed profiles for individual-specific experiences across all channels.
Major companies show how powerful this approach can be. Amazon’s APIs merge inventory, order management, and customer data across online and mobile platforms. Starbucks creates connected experiences through its mobile app. Customers order ahead, earn rewards, and pay smoothly—all through robust API integration.
Conclusion
Single Page Applications redefine how users engage with websites, delivering speed and responsiveness. React, Vue, and Angular dominate frontend development, while WebAssembly enhances performance for resource-intensive tasks. API-first strategies further streamline software architecture, enabling omnichannel connectivity. Businesses adopting these technologies gain a competitive edge, offering faster, more dynamic digital experiences. Forward-thinking web development companies already integrate these innovations to build scalable, high-performance solutions. Staying ahead means embracing these advancements today.
Source: The Rise of Single Page Applications in Modern Web Development